OBITUARY: Joyce O. Morseth

Funeral service for Joyce Morseth will be at 11AM on Wednesday, March 25, 2009 at Lands Lutheran Church, 16640 Highway 60 Blvd., Zumbrota with Reverend David Krinke officiating. Burial will follow at Lands Lutheran Church Cemetery. Memorials are preferred to the Goodhue County Food Shelf or to the charity of one's choice.

Joyce, age 87, of Wanamingo and formerly Zumbrota, died on Saturday, March 21, 2009 at Saint Mary's Hospital in Rochester. She was born Joyce Orris Ellefson on August 28, 1921 in Roscoe Township, Goodhue County to Ole and Josephine (nee Johnson) Ellefson. She attended rural country school in Roscoe Township and worked for the Zumbrota Hotel. On June 21, 1941, Joyce married Alfred Morseth at the Lands Lutheran Church parsonage. Following their marriage, the couple lived in Zumbrota before they started farming around the area eventually purchasing their farm south of Pine Island and farmed for over 33 years. In addition to farming, Joyce worked as a volunteer at Pine Haven Care Center. She did this over 30 years as well as was a lifetime member of Lands Lutheran Church. She was active in the ladies circles and auxiliaries as well as a teacher in Sunday school for over 35 years. She worked with the Dodge County Extension Group and was a 4-H leader. She loved to can and bake as proof of many blue ribbons earned at the Dodge County and Goodhue County Fairs.

Joyce is survived by her husband, Alfred, of Wanamingo; four children: Marlys Sherbel and Harold (Pam) Morseth, all of Coon Rapids, MN, Bonnie (Stan) Broton, of Dodge Center and Mary (Myron) Ehrich, of West Concord; four grandchildren: Darin and Erin Borton, Kari (David) Echtenkamp and Kristi (Jeffery) Stradtmann; three great-grandchildren: Dylan and Madelyn Echtenkamp and Logan Stradtmann. She was preceded in death by her parents, Ole and Josephine; five brothers: Martin, Herman, Gilman, Orrin and Lyle and two sisters: Lillian and Margaret.

Visitation will be from 5-8PM on Tuesday at the Mahn Family Funeral Home � Larson Chapel in Zumbrota and one hour before services at the church on Wednesday.
